We'll be back soon. In the meantime... keep it moving

  • 32 calf rises each leg! – keep it slow and controlled
  • 30 glute bridges – lengthen through the floor
  • 1 minute plank - embrace the shakes!
  • 4 x 30 second balances in retiré each side – if you fall, we start from the top!
  • Practice your pirouettes from 5th and 4th each side. Try each turn until you feel 1 percent progress
  • An arabesque each side – master it, and make it clean
  • 1 minute butterfly stretch – breathe, don’t force, keep your back long and actively push the knees out

Ep. 167 Failures & Mistakes Are Not Your Identity

May 20th 2026

Hey Everyone!

We need to talk about failure.

Not in a “dust yourself off and try again” motivational poster kind of way. Really talk about it. Because so many of us — especially as dancers — have spent years quietly believing that every mistake we make says something about who we are.

A wobbled pirouette, a bad audition, a class where nothing went right. And instead of letting it go, we become it.

This episode is about untangling that.

Failure is not your identity. It is information. It is redirection. It is, honestly, one of the most powerful tools you have — but only if you stop running from it and start getting curious about it.

In this episode we’re talking about:

🎙️ Why we attach our sense of self worth to our mistakes — and how to stop

🎙️ The difference between having a bad experience and being a failure

🎙️ How embracing mistakes (rather than burying them) is what separates dancers who grow from dancers who plateau

🎙️ Practical ways to reframe failure in the moment — on and off the dance floor

🎙️ Why the most successful, most celebrated artists in the world have failure woven all the way through their story

Because here’s the truth — the mistake doesn’t define you. What you do with it does.
